Nra Freedom Action Foundation (EIN: 26-1277941) has filed an IRS Form 990 since fiscal year 2018. In its fiscal year 2019 IRS Form 990 filing, Nra Freedom Action Foundation,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 8 employ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$617,603. The highest compensated employee at Nra Freedom Action Foundation is Chris Cox with fiscal year 2019 compensation of $1,572,525.

Mission Statement

TO EDUCATE CITIZENS WITH RESPECT TO: THEIR INDIVIDUAL RIGHTS AS CITIZENS, THE IMPORTANCE OF THE SECOND AMENDMENT TO THE CONSTITUTION OF THE UNITED STATES AND THEIR RESPECTIVE RIGHTS THEREUNDER, AND THE ROLE OF AMERICA'S COURTS IN PROTECTING SUCH RIGHTS; ENGAGE IN NONPARTISAN VOTER REGISTRATION; AND PARTICIPATE IN ANY OTHER ACTIVITIES RELATING TO THE SECOND AMENDMENT AS ARE APPROPRIATE.
